Sumario:A measurement of the cross-section for Z$^0\rightarrow$ e$^+$e$^-$ at $\sqrt{s}$ = 7 TeV is presented using LHCb data recorded in 2011 cor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 945 pb$^{-1}$. Within the kinematic acceptance, $p_{\mathrm{T}}$ > 20 GeV and 2 < $\eta$ < 4.5 for the leptons and 60 < $M$ < 120 GeV and 2 < $y$ < 4 for the Z$^0$, the cross-section is measured to be \begin{align} \sigma(Z^0 \to e^+ e^-) = 75.7 \pm 0.5 \mathrm{(stat.)} \pm 2.4 \mathrm{(syst.)} \pm 2.6 \mathrm{(lumi.) pb.} \end{align} The results are compared with previous measurements and with theoretical predictions using QCD at NNLO.
